Ventura County Board Approves Lease for New Family Justice Center at California Lutheran University
The Ventura County Board of Supervisors has approved a lease for the establishment of the East County Family Justice Center at California Lutheran University. This new center aims to provide comprehensive support services for victims and survivors of violence and abuse, consolidating these services under one roof. The initiative is a collaboration between the Ventura County Family Justice Center and California Lutheran University, reflecting a longstanding partnership. District Attorney Erik Nasarenko highlighted the partnership as an example of effective collaboration between public institutions and educational partners to enhance community safety and strength. California Lutheran University President John A. Nunes emphasized the university's commitment to advancing justice, compassion, and healing through this initiative.
